Experience the fascinating story of Nova Hall, whose discovery of a lost and forgotten collection of photographs, documents, and personal correspondence with Charles A. Lindbergh revealed the amazing work of his grandfather, Donald A. Hall Sr. – one of the most famous aircraft engineers in American history. Despite passing away before Nova was born, Donald A. Hall Sr.’s work designing, engineering, and constructing the Spirit of St. Louis would forever shape aviation history. Thanks to Nova’s discovery, this incredible collection has been preserved and shared through the Flying Over Time exhibition.
